An Associate Product Manager (APM) is an entry-level product development role that supports senior product managers and teams by conducting market research, analyzing data, gathering product requirements, assisting in product planning, and coordinating with engineering, marketing, and design teams to help launch and iterate on new products or features. Key responsibilities include documenting user needs, tracking product performance metrics, collaborating on product roadmaps, and providing general support to ensure product goals are met.

Key Responsibilities

Market Research: Researching market trends, customer needs, and the competitive landscape to identify opportunities.

Product Planning: Assisting in the creation and maintenance of product roadmaps and release plans, and breaking down strategy into actionable initiatives.

Requirement Gathering: Documenting product requirements, translating user needs into actionable tasks for development teams, and maintaining product documentation.

Cross-Functional Collaboration: Working closely with engineering, design, marketing, and quality assurance teams to align on product goals and timelines.

Data Analysis: Monitoring product performance metrics and user feedback to identify areas for improvement.

Product Development Support: Supporting the development and delivery of new features and helping with product launches.

Testing and Quality Assurance: Participating in testing activities to ensure the product meets requirements.

Learning and Growth: Gaining exposure to product management by working with senior managers and learning from experienced professionals.

Skills and Qualifications

Analytical Skills: Strong ability to collect, interpret, and analyze data from various sources.

Problem-Solving: Ability to identify challenges and find creative solutions within the product development process.

Communication Skills: Effective communication to collaborate with different teams and clearly document requirements.

Collaboration and Teamwork: Desire to work as part of a team and a willingness to learn from others.

Curiosity and a Desire to Learn: Essential traits for an entry-level role where skills are developed on the job.

Education and Experience: Typically requires a bachelor's degree in a relevant field, such as computer science or product development, and often some prior experience in product development.
